The Sanibel Historical Museum & Village is scheduled to reopen for the season and are planning a special holiday celebration on Friday, Dec. 1. The regular operating schedule, from 10 a.m. to 4 p.m. Tuesdays to Saturdays, will resume on Saturday, Dec. 2.
The celebration on Dec. 1, “Deck the Shore,” will be from 4 to 6 p.m. Welcome remarks will be given at 4 p.m. and a Lighthouse themed tree lighting ceremony will be at 5:45 p.m. In between, guests can stroll the Historical Village while enjoying cookies, treats, wine, cheese and punch. Guests will also be serenaded with Christmas carols by the BIG ARTS Community Chorus from 4:30 to 5:45 p.m.
Next door, BIG ARTS will be hosting an open house from 5 to 7 p.m. with an appearance from Santa Claus, artist demonstrations and refreshments. Both events that evening will be free of charge.
